Biography

Mary McCarthy was born on June 21, 1912 in Seattle, Washington, USA. She was a writer, known for The Group (1966), Women and Men: Stories of Seduction (1990) and Ford Star Revue (1950). She was married to James Raymond West, Robert Bowden Broadwater, Edmund Wilson Jr. and Harold Johnsrud. She died on October 25, 1989 in New York City, New York, USA.
